Quick Answer

The technical skills required for software engineers include strong proficiency in programming languages such as C#, Java, or Python, deep understanding of data structures and algorithms, object-oriented design, version control using Git, and troubleshooting/debugging abilities. Additionally, experience with tools like Visual Studio, Azure DevOps, and familiarity with cloud platforms like Azure are increasingly important for software engineering roles in India.

    Common Mistakes

    Many candidates misunderstand what “technical skills required for software engineers” really means and end up making avoidable mistakes that hurt their chances.

    1. Only listing skills, not showing application:
    - Resumes that say “Proficient in Java, Git” without mentioning projects or results get ignored by recruiters.

    2. Weak grasp of algorithms and data structures:
    - Struggling to solve real algorithmic problems is a leading cause of interview rejection, especially for campus hires.

    3. Neglecting Git or using it superficially:
    - Not having a public GitHub portfolio or failing to use advanced Git commands signals lack of practical experience.

    4. Ignoring collaborative tools:
    - Never using JIRA, Azure DevOps, or similar tools puts you behind candidates with team development exposure.

    5. Focusing only on coding, ignoring problem-solving and teamwork:
    - Modern software development is a team sport; failing to discuss teamwork, code reviews, or CI/CD exposure is a red flag.

    6. Generic applications:
    - Sending standard resumes or not tailoring your skill highlights for roles using the Microsoft technology stack (e.g., Azure) can cost you interview calls.

    Action Plan

    Use this step-by-step approach to acquire and demonstrate the core technical skills required for software engineers, specifically in Indian and global tech job markets.

    1. Select and master at least one high-level programming language

    • Choose C#, Java, or Python (focus on the language relevant to your target companies).
    • Build small-to-large projects, participate in hackathons, and solve problems on online judges (LeetCode, HackerRank).

    2. Deepen understanding of data structures and algorithms

    • Take focused courses or tutorials.
    • Practice coding problems that are commonly asked in interviews, emphasizing efficiency and scalability.

    3. Implement object-oriented design in code

    • Structure your projects using OOP concepts, demonstrate with class hierarchies, and design patterns.
    • Share code samples on your portfolio or GitHub.

    4. Gain proficiency with version control (Git)

    • Use Git for all your coding work, understand merge conflicts, pull requests, and collaboration workflows.
    • Share links to your active repositories on your resume and LinkedIn.

    5. Learn and use industry tools

    • Download and use Visual Studio or VS Code for code development.
    • Get hands-on with Azure DevOps for CI/CD pipelines, JIRA for project tracking, and Microsoft Teams for collaboration.

    6. Get certified when possible

    • Pursue certifications like Microsoft Certified: Azure Fundamentals or Azure Developer Associate to validate your cloud skills.
    • Add credentials to LinkedIn and resume.

    7. Practice troubleshooting and debugging

    • Intentionally build and fix buggy code.
    • Document how you identified and fixed issues—this shows problem-solving depth.

    8. Prioritize teamwork and communication

    • Volunteer for team projects at college, internships, or open-source communities.
    • Be prepared to discuss your contributions during interviews.

FAQ

1. Which are the most essential technical skills required for software engineers in India right now?
Proficiency in a programming language (C#, Java, or Python), data structures and algorithms, version control with Git, and experience with cloud platforms like Azure are currently most in demand.

2. How can I prove my technical skills to recruiters and hiring managers?
Maintain a public GitHub portfolio with real projects, obtain relevant certifications, and clearly describe hands-on experience in your resume and LinkedIn profile.

3. Are certifications like Microsoft Certified: Azure Developer Associate necessary?
While not mandatory, certifications provide added credibility and help you stand out during screening for cloud and full-stack roles, especially in companies using the Microsoft tech stack.

4. What tools should I be comfortable with as a software engineer aiming for top product companies?
You should know how to use development tools like Visual Studio, code repositories with Git/GitHub, project trackers like JIRA, and cloud services such as Microsoft Azure.

5. What career paths can I pursue after starting as a software engineer?
Common paths include Senior Software Engineer, Technical Lead, Engineering Manager, and Architect, each requiring progressive mastery of both technical and leadership skills.
